DVP vacuum pumps with PFPE oil for modified atmosphere packaging

Lubricated Rotary Vane Vacuum Pumps with PFPE Oil: your solution for modified atmosphere packaging

Increasingly used in the food packaging industry, modified atmosphere or protective packaging (MAP) extends the shelf life of fresh food without adding additives. To meet this specific application, DVP Vacuum Technology has developed the series of Lubricated Rotary Vane Vacuum Pumps with PFPE oil from 8 to 365 m3/h.

Modified atmosphere packaging preserves the organoleptic properties of fresh foods for longer and keeps them from spoiling thanks to gas mixtures, generally carbon dioxide, nitrogen and oxygen, contained in the atmosphere inside the package.

When the percentage of oxygen is high, the use of traditional oils in the pumps located inside the packaging machines can cause dangerous situations for the working environment. The right solution is the use of the DVP series of Lubricated Rotary Vane Vacuum Pumps with PFPE oil, the special range of pumps with a distinctive red color.

PFPE oil is a special lubricant that is non-reactive to oxygen and 100% non-flammable, ensuring total safety for the pump and machinery. It is also optimal for use in the food industry because it is completely odorless and colorless.

DVP Lubricated Vane Vacuum Pumps with PFPE oil are highly resistant to water vapor suction and are equipped with FKM rubber components, features that make them widely used in the food packaging industry.

DVP Side Channel Blowers

DVP side channel blowers: what are they for, how do they work, and where are they used?

What are side channel blowers used for?

DVP Side channel blowers are blowers designed to compress or suck clean air, air or gas mixtures and inert gases.
Compared to traditional Rotary vane vacuum pumps, they guarantee a total absence of maintenance and maximum silence in the working area.
Installation is simple and does not require any particular effort: it is sufficient to consult the installation manual and follow the suggested procedure step by step.

How do they work?

The working principle of DVP Side channel blowers is based on the rotation of an impeller equipped with small vanes inside a stator.
Thanks to the centrifugal force generated by the rotation. air vortexes are created that are dragged by the intake vanes towards the discharge.
The operation of these turbines is dry, i.e., without lubrication, and ensures the absence of oil from compressed fluids.

Where are they used?

It is possible to use them on machines and industrial plants that require suction and delivery pressures, maximum operational safety, and low noise emissions.
In the environmental sector their use is particularly suitable for the oxygenation and purification of wastewater and in waste disposal plants.
The DVP blowers can also be used in the field of pneumatic conveying in suction and compression for the handling of dusty materials and in the industry of food packaging automatic lines.

DVP supplies a wide range of single-stage, double-stage, double-parallel stage, and triple-stage turbines with single-phase or three-phase high-efficiency IE3 motors. Some models are available with front suction inlet. All versions can be used as compressors. If used as a compressor, the output flow is clean and free of pulsations.

BI-REX Competence Center-DVP

BI-REX Competence Center, our commitment to industrial digital development.

As technology & service provider to the Competence Center BI-REX (Big Data Innovation & Research EXcellence), DVP Vacuum Technology provides expertise and equipment in the Pilot Plant for the implementation of technology & industrial digital development projects.

BI-REX is one of the 8 Italian Competence Centers funded by the Italian Ministry of the Economic Development, within the Industry 4.0 National Plan. Born in 2018 to assist companies, especially SMEs, in the adoption of enabling technologies, BI-REX is a public-private Consortium and sees the involvement of 56 actors including Universities, Research Centers and Companies from different sectors.

Among the services offered, the BI-REX Pilot Plant replicates a complete production system available to large and medium-small companies for innovation, "Test Before Invest" activities and training. Located in the BI-REX headquarters in Bologna, the plant is an example of a Smart Factory where traditional technologies are integrated with the innovative ones of Industry 4.0, with the aim of anticipating digital transformation processes and increasing the added value of the company's products.

Thanks to DVP LAB, our Research & Innovation laboratory, always involved in interacting with industrial partners and Universities to develop innovative scenarios in the Vacuum Pumps sector, we are engaged in supporting the technological innovation of companies. In particular, we provide the following services to the BI-REX Pilot Plant:

  • Certified test bench for air positive displacement pumps (flow rate, pressure, temperature, electrical parameters)
  • FDM 3D printing. Printing area: 200 x 250 x 200 mm. Available materials: PLA – Nylon
  • Certified instruments: TSI Dustrack II photometer for environmental concentration measurements and Spectra Apollo Light 4-channel vibro-acoustic meter
  • Certified low pressure test bench (up to 10-7 mbar abs)
  • Certified DEA Mistral CMM for high precision measurements.

DVP collaborates with UniBo Motorsport to produce the electric race car

As a manufacturer of vacuum technologies applied to the processing of composite materials and as a promoter of sustainable innovation, DVP enthusiastically welcomed the collaboration with UniBo Motorsport to produce the Elettra GN electric formula-style car.

Founded in 2009 by a group of engineering students with a common passion for the world of cars and motorcycles, UniBo Motorsport is the Racing Team of the University of Bologna. The competition challenges teams of university students to conceive, design, fabricate, develop, and compete with formula style race cars.

Unveiled in July, Elettra GN is the result of an efficient teamwork based on the cohesion between each Team member and the exchange of information and knowledge, to optimize all the development phases of the project. The students thus had the opportunity to discuss and put into practice the knowledge acquired during the academic years about electric cars and eco-friendly mobility.

For the construction of the carbon fiber body shell, the Racing Team of the University of Bologna  used NEPTUNUS 25, a DVP Vacuum System, with 25-liter tank and LC 25 Vacuum Pump, specially customized according to the technical needs of the team.

The vacuum created by the DVP Vacuum System during the vacuum bagging process not only made the laminate extremely compact, but also removed the moisture in the composite material and excess resin, maximizing the overall stiffness and performance of the resulting product.
